Should I buy a 6 cylinder or 8 cylinder truck?

In recent years, V6 engines have seen major advances in power, torque, gas mileage and towing capacity. However, a V8 is likely the smarter choice if you often tow and haul heavy loads, especially if the V6 truck you're considering doesn't offer a turbocharged or diesel engine option.

Why is a V8 engine good?

An eight-cylinder engine, the V8, is common in pickup trucks, SUVs and sportscars, because these engines create a lot of horsepower and torque and are better suited to tow or haul. It usually has between four and six litres of displacement, depending on the size of the eight cylinders within.

Why do V6 and v8 sound different?

Different configurations of engines differ in sound due to the values of the dominant frequency emitted from each motor. To calculate this frequency, the engine speed has to be broken down from revolutions per minute to revolutions per second, which is simply dividing the RPM value by sixty.

Why do American cars have low horsepower?

Large displacement American V8s are typically pushrod engines, and this engine design has characteristics that make it more difficult to produce high horsepower per liter.
